税收审计-税收管征审计-税收征管总体审计分析
词条类别
审计知识方法
资源分类
税收征管总体审计分析
词条名称
行业缴纳增值税分析审计方法
时 间
2016-03-31
作 者
中国审计学会计算机审计分会长沙特派办课题组
词条摘要
按照税务登记的行业对门类、大类进行分析,从地区、行业、增值税、期间等多角度分析纳税情况,为确定审计工作重点和审计建议提供依据。
一、概念
按照税务登记的行业进行分析,从地区、行业、增值税、期间等多角度分析纳税情况。
二、审计目标
分析某地域重点行业纳增值税基本状况和发展变化规律,为下步审计工作提供参考依据。
三、所需数据
行业代码。数据元素:中类标志、门类标志、大类标志、行业代码、上级行业代码、选用标志、有效标志、行业名称、小类标志。
纳税人基本信息。数据元素:登记序号、登记机关代码、税收档案编号、纳税人识别号、纳税人名称、组织机构代码、法定代表人(负责人、业主)身份证件种类代码、法定代表人(负责人、业主)身份证件号码、法定代表人(负责人、业主)姓名、数据归属地区、数据归属日期、登记日期、增值税企业类型代码、税务登记类型代码、登记注册类型代码、生产经营地址、生产经营地址行政区划数字代码、临时税务登记类型代码、纳税人状态代码、行业代码、注册地址、注册地址行政区划数字代码、街道乡镇代码、单位隶属关系代码、国地管户类型代码、主管税务局代码、主管税务所(科、分局)代码、税收管理员代码、代扣代缴标志、委托代征标志、户籍所在地、经营范围、录入人代码、录入日期、修改人代码、修改日期、国地税类型代码。
缴款书。数据元素:系统税票序号、征收序号、纳税人电子档案号、被代扣代缴纳税人名称、所属时期起、所属时期止、征收项目代码、征收品目代码、税款种类代码、税款属性代码、申报方式代码、应征凭证序号、应征发生日期、课税税量、销售收入、税率、单位税额、实缴税额、税票种类代码、开票人代码、开票日期、系统税票号码、印刷税票号码、登记注册类型、行业代码、预算科目代码、预算分配比例代码、征收方式代码、收款国库代码、银行种类代码、银行代码、银行帐号、税票缴款期限、汇总缴款书标志、备注、缴款方式、银税交易号、银税操作状态、预计发送保留时间、转帐专用完税证打印日期、转帐专用完税证打印人、入库日期、调帐类型代码、调帐日期、作废人代码、作废日期、税票作废类型、街道乡镇代码、税务人员代码、税款所属税务机关代码、征收机关代码、纳税人税务机关代码、税务机关代码。
税务机构代码。数据元素:税务机关代码、税务机关名称、税务机构简称、办税服务厅标志、传真电话、电子信箱、国地税类型代码、机构级次代码、上级税务机关代码、税务机构标志、税务机构局轨、税务机构邮政编码、税务机关地址、税务机关负责人代码、税务机关联系电话、行政区划数字代码、选用标志、有效标志、有效起始日期、有效终止日期。
四、分析步骤
步骤一:从“纳税人应缴税费账户”中选取2012年以后的需要用作统计税收的字段,即登记序号、征收项目、税额、入库日期等。
步骤二:统计企业纳税总额,征收项目'10100'表示“税收收入”,该征收项目下级包括增值税10101、消费税10102、所得税100104等。
步骤三:统计企业缴纳增值税,征收项目代码为100101。
步骤四:(1)将步骤二至三生成的税额表关联,生成M2_DWJ_企业税收基础表;
(2)更新M2_DWJ_企业税收基础表的其他税款字段,其他税款=税收收入汇总-增值税汇总。
步骤七:生成M2_DWJ_行业代码表(四级代码信息)。
步骤八:根据M2_DWJ_企业税收基础表和M2_DWJ_行业代码表(四级代码信息),生成按照一级行业纳税汇总信息。
步骤九:根据M2_DWJ_企业税收基础表和M2_DWJ_行业代码表(四级代码信息),生成按照二级行业纳税汇总信息。
步骤十:将2012年税收收入合计与按照一级代码行业汇总及其下属二级代码行业汇总合并显示出结果数据。
步骤十一:选择某二级代码行业时,生成该行业税款总额2012年度排名前50位的企业。
五、计算机语言
--步骤一:生成上解入库原始表
CREATE TABLE上解入库原始表AS SELECT djxh登记序号,ZSXM_DM征收项目代码,rkrq入库日期,SJJE实缴金额,HY_DM行业代码,zgswskfj_dm主管税务所代码
FROM HX_ZS.ZS_JKS
WHERE substr(SKSSSWJG_DM,1,1)='1'--执行参数国地税
and substr(SKSSSWJG_DM,2,2)='50'--执行参数s省市
and to_char(RKRQ,'yyyy')>=(to_char(sysdate, 'yyyy')-3)
AND CZLX_DM!='50';
--步骤二:生成中间表M2_DWJ_企业纳税汇总
CREATE TABLE M2_DWJ_企业纳税汇总AS SELECT登记序号,行业代码,SUM(实缴金额)税收收入汇总,
to_char(入库日期,'yyyy')年份FROM上解入库原始表WHERE substr(征收项目代码,1,3)='101'GROUP BY登记序号,行业代码,to_char(入库日期,'yyyy');
--步骤三:生成中间表M2_DWJ_企业增值税
CREATE TABLE M2_DWJ_企业增值税AS SELECT登记序号,行业代码,SUM(实缴金额)增值税汇总,to_char(入库日期,'yyyy')年份FROM上解入库原始表WHERE征收项目代码='10101'GROUP BY登记序号,行业代码,
to_char(入库日期,'yyyy');
--步骤四:生成中间表M2_DWJ_企业税收基础表
create table M2_DWJ_企业税收基础表as SELECT A.登记序号,A.行业代码,A.税收收入汇总,A.年份,case when B.增值税汇总is null then 0 else B.增值税汇总end增值税汇总,A.税收收入汇总-增值税汇总AS其他税款FROM M2_DWJ_企业纳税汇总A FULL JOIN M2_DWJ_企业增值税B ON A.登记序号=B.登记序号AND A.行业代码=B.行业代码and A.年份=B.年份;
--步骤五:生成中间表M2_DWJ_行业代码表(四级代码信息)
CREATE TABLE M2_DWJ_行业代码AS SELECT A.HY_DM四级,A.HYMC四级名称,B.HY_DM三级,B.HYMC三级名称, C.HY_DM二级,C.HYMC二级名称,D.HY_DM一级,D.HYMC一级名称FROM HX_ZSJ.DM_GY_HY A JOIN HX_ZSJ.DM_GY_HY B ON A.SJHY_DM=B.HY_DM JOIN HX_ZSJ.DM_GY_HY C ON B.SJHY_DM=C.HY_DM JOIN HX_ZSJ.DM_GY_HY D ON C.SJHY_DM =D.HY_DM WHERE LENGTH(A.HY_DM)=4 AND LENGTH(B.HY_DM) =3 AND LENGTH(C.HY_DM)=2 AND LENGTH(D.HY_DM)=1;
--步骤六:生成中间表M2_DWJ_一级行业纳税
create table M2_DWJ_一级行业纳税as select b.一级排序代码,b.一级行业代码,b.一级名称行业名称,a.年份,sum(a.税收收入汇总)税收收入合计,sum(a.增值税汇总)增值税,sum(a.其他税款)其他税款from M2_DWJ_企业税收基础表a join M2_DWJ_行业代码b on a.行业代码=b.四级group by b.一级,b.一级名称,a.年份union (select'Z'排序代码,'Z'行业代码,'其他行业'行业名称,年份,sum(税收收入汇总),sum(增值税汇总)from M2_DWJ_企业税收基础表where行业代码is null group by年份);
--步骤九:生成中间表M2_DWJ_二级行业纳税
create table M2_DWJ_二级行业纳税as select
concat(一级,二级)排序代码,b.二级行业代码,b.二级名称行业名称,a.年份,sum(a.税收收入汇总)税收收入合计,sum(a.增值税汇总)增值税,sum(a.其他税款)其他税款from M2_DWJ_企业税收基础表a join M2_DWJ_行业代码b on a.行业代码=b.四级group by concat(一级,二级),b.二级,b.二级名称,a.年份;
--查看
--将2012年税收收入合计与按照一级代码行业汇总及其下属二级代码行业汇总合并显示出结果数据
--输入条件:年份(2012)
select'000'排序代码,'000'行业代码,'税收收入合计'行业名称,a.年份,sum(a.税收收入汇总)税收收入合计,sum(a.增值税汇总)增值税,sum(a.其他税款)其他税款from M2_DWJ_企业税收基础表a where a.年份=? group by a.年份union select*from M2_DWJ_一级行业纳税b where b.年份=?Union select*from M2_DWJ_二级行业纳税c where c.年份=?;
--选择某二级代码行业时,生成该行业税款总额排名前50位的企业
--传入的参数:行业代码(行业代码),年份(入库日期) select企业名称,纳税人识别号,主管税务机关局,税收收入汇总,增值税汇总,其他税款from((select c.nsrmc企业名称,b.二级行业代码,a.年份年份,
c.nsrsbh纳税人识别号,d.swjgmc主管税务机关局,A.税收收入汇总,a.增值税汇总,a.其他税款from M2_DWJ_企业税收基础表a join M2_DWJ_行业代码b on a.行业代码= b.四级join hx_dj.dj_nsrxx c on a.登记序号=c.djxh join HX_ZSJ.DM_GY_SWJG don c.ZGSWJ_DM=d.swjg_dm) union(select c.nsrmc企业名称,''行业代码,a.年份年份,c.nsrsbh纳税人识别号,d.swjgmc主管税务机关局, A.税收收入汇总,a.增值税汇总,a.其他税款from M2_DWJ_企业税收基础表a join hx_dj.dj_nsrxx c on a.登记序号=c.djxh join HX_ZSJ.DM_GY_SWJG d on c.ZGSWJ_DM= d.swjg_dm where a.行业代码is null))where行业代码=?and年份=?order by税收收入汇总desc;
六、延伸建议
按照税务登记的行业对门类、大类进行分析,从地区、行业、税种、期间等多角度分析纳税情况,为确定审计工作重点和审计建议提供依据。
参考文献
科技部国家“十二五”科技支撑项目“中央税收收入征管政策执行效果联网审计预警分析研究及审计应用”研究成果:《国税审计方法体系》